@@ -485,30 +485,30 @@ func (e *TableMapEvent) Dump(w io.Writer) {
485
485
}
486
486
}
487
487
if e .IsEnumColumn (i ) {
488
+ if len (enumSetCollationMap ) == 0 {
489
+ fmt .Fprintf (w , " enum_collation=<n/a>" )
490
+ } else {
491
+ fmt .Fprintf (w , " enum_collation=%d" , enumSetCollationMap [i ])
492
+ }
493
+
488
494
if len (enumStrValueMap ) == 0 {
489
495
fmt .Fprintf (w , " enum=<n/a>" )
490
496
} else {
491
497
fmt .Fprintf (w , " enum=%v" , enumStrValueMap [i ])
492
498
}
493
-
499
+ }
500
+ if e .IsSetColumn (i ) {
494
501
if len (enumSetCollationMap ) == 0 {
495
- fmt .Fprintf (w , " enum_collation =<n/a>" )
502
+ fmt .Fprintf (w , " set_collation =<n/a>" )
496
503
} else {
497
- fmt .Fprintf (w , " enum_collation =%d" , enumSetCollationMap [i ])
504
+ fmt .Fprintf (w , " set_collation =%d" , enumSetCollationMap [i ])
498
505
}
499
- }
500
- if e .IsSetColumn (i ) {
506
+
501
507
if len (setStrValueMap ) == 0 {
502
508
fmt .Fprintf (w , " set=<n/a>" )
503
509
} else {
504
510
fmt .Fprintf (w , " set=%v" , setStrValueMap [i ])
505
511
}
506
-
507
- if len (enumSetCollationMap ) == 0 {
508
- fmt .Fprintf (w , " set_collation=<n/a>" )
509
- } else {
510
- fmt .Fprintf (w , " set_collation=%d" , enumSetCollationMap [i ])
511
- }
512
512
}
513
513
if e .IsGeometryColumn (i ) {
514
514
if len (geometryTypeMap ) == 0 {
0 commit comments